Course Content

• Environmental Conflict Analysis and Assessment
• Mediation and Negotiation Skills for Environmental Disputes
• Environmental Law and Policy for Conflict Resolution
• Stakeholder Engagement and Communication in Environmental Planning
• Collaborative Planning and Decision-Making for Sustainable Development
• Conflict Resolution Techniques: Facilitation and Arbitration
• Environmental Impact Assessment and Conflict Mitigation
• Climate Change Adaptation and Conflict Management

Career path

Career Prospects: Conflict Resolution & Environmental Planning in the UK

Role Description
Environmental Consultant (Conflict Resolution Specialist) Mediates disputes concerning environmental projects, applying conflict resolution techniques and environmental planning expertise. High demand due to increasing environmental regulations.
Sustainability Officer (Dispute Resolution) Manages environmental conflicts within organizations, promoting sustainable practices and resolving internal and external disputes. Strong growth in the sector.
Planning Officer (Environmental Mediation) Resolves planning disputes related to environmental impact, utilizing conflict resolution skills to facilitate agreement between stakeholders and planners. Essential role in local authorities.
Environmental Mediator/Arbitrator Independent professional specializing in resolving environmental conflicts through mediation or arbitration. High earning potential with specialized expertise.
